Infineon PTMA080152M: A Comprehensive Technical Overview

The Infineon PTMA080152M represents a significant advancement in the realm of power management, specifically engineered for high-efficiency, high-power-density applications. As a member of Infineon's esteemed POL (Point-of-Load) converter family, this DC-DC power module is designed to meet the rigorous demands of modern computing, telecommunications, and industrial systems. Its architecture integrates the majority of necessary components into a single, compact package, simplifying design-in and accelerating time-to-market for engineers.

A primary feature of the PTMA080152M is its exceptionally wide input voltage (VIN) range, typically from 4.5 V to 16 V. This flexibility makes it an ideal solution for intermediate bus architectures commonly powered by 5 V, 12 V, or tightly regulated 12 V batteries. The module delivers a precisely regulated output voltage, adjustable from 0.6 V to 3.6 V, catering to the low-voltage, high-current requirements of advanced ASICs, FPGAs, DSPs, and microprocessors. With a formidable continuous output current (IOUT) capability of up to 15 A, it can power the most demanding processor cores and memory arrays.

The module's efficiency is a cornerstone of its design. Utilizing a synchronous buck topology with advanced control schemes, it achieves peak efficiency exceeding 95%. This high efficiency is maintained across a broad load range, which is critical for minimizing power losses and thermal dissipation in space-constrained, thermally sensitive applications. The reduction of heat generation allows for simpler thermal management and enhances overall system reliability.

Beyond raw power delivery, the PTMA080152M is equipped with a comprehensive suite of advanced management and protection features. These include:

Precision Enable/Inhibit Control: For precise power sequencing.

Power Good (PG) Signal: Provides a logic output indicating the output voltage is within regulation.

Programmable Soft-Start: Limits inrush current at startup, preventing unwanted voltage dips on the input bus.

Over-Current Protection (OCP): Safeguards the module and load during fault conditions.

Over-Temperature Protection (OTP): Shuts down the module if the internal temperature exceeds safe limits.

Packaged in a compact and low-profile 8.0 x 11.5 x 3.75 mm LGA (Land Grid Array) housing, the module offers a superior power-density solution. This small footprint, combined with its high level of integration—incorporating power MOSFETs, inductors, and controllers—significantly reduces the overall PCB area and component count compared to discrete solutions.
